Fexofenadine is an antihistamine medication used to relieve symptoms of allergic rhinitis and urticaria.
Direction of Use: Fexofenadine is taken orally, usually once a day. The duration of treatment will depend on the condition being treated and the patient’s response to the medication.
Contraindication: Fexofenadine should not be used in people who are allergic to fexofenadine or other antihistamines.
Doses and Administration: The usual adult dose is 180mg once daily. Doses may vary for children and for patients with kidney or liver disease.
Side Effects: Common side effects include headache, nausea, and diarrhea.
Interactions: Fexofenadine may interact with other medications, such as ketoconazole, erythromycin, and warfarin. It is important to inform your healthcare provider of all medications and supplements you are taking before starting treatment with fexofenadine.
Warnings and Precautions: Fexofenadine is not recommended for use during pregnancy and breastfeeding. It may cause drowsiness, so it’s important to avoid driving or operating heavy machinery until the effects of the medication are known. It’s also important to inform your healthcare provider if you have any history of heart disease, high blood pressure, or diabetes before taking this medication.
